Abstract

A one-port SAW resonator incorporating Langmuir-Blodgett (LB) films has been investigated for a sensing element of chemical sensor. A 90 MHz SAW chemical sensor have been fabricated on ST cut quartz substrate and one-port resonator configuration have been used as a sensing element. Selective coatings have been deposited by the Langmuir-Blodgett method. The resonance frequency and the Q value have been measured as sensor response. Experimental results shown that the Q value and the resonance frequency of the one-port SAW resonator varied with the mass loading on SAW device surface. Especially, it was found that the measurement of Q value is very suitable for SAW sensor response.
